E Construction, a subsidiary of N.P.A., a Division of Colas Western Canada Inc. is one of Western Canada’s largest paving contractors, with over 700 employees helping us provide our products and services throughout Alberta, Saskatchewan and the Northwest Territories. Our equipment fleet and shops are among the most modern in our business. Responsibilities
  • Complete material sampling and testing at a standard that will satisfy contract requirements and ensure proper quality control.
  • Onsite document control.
  • Test road construction materials, such as asphalt, concreate, pavement and aggregate.
  • Ensure compliance with testing standards.
  • Mobile lab set-up and tear down.
